This commit is contained in:
@@ -13,7 +13,7 @@ export const Route = createRootRoute({
|
||||
function Root() {
|
||||
return (
|
||||
<Theme>
|
||||
<Container>
|
||||
<Container mb="4">
|
||||
<Flex direction="row" justify="center" align="center" gap="2">
|
||||
<Link to="/">Index</Link>
|
||||
<Link to="/blank">Blank</Link>
|
||||
|
||||
@@ -1,4 +1,5 @@
|
||||
import { runtime } from "@/runtime"
|
||||
import { Todos } from "@/todo/Todos"
|
||||
import { TodosState } from "@/todo/TodosState.service"
|
||||
import { createFileRoute } from "@tanstack/react-router"
|
||||
import { Effect, pipe } from "effect"
|
||||
@@ -7,9 +8,11 @@ import { ReactComponent, ReactHook } from "effect-fc"
|
||||
|
||||
export const Route = createFileRoute("/")({
|
||||
component: pipe(
|
||||
Effect.fn(function*() {
|
||||
const context = yield* ReactHook.useMemoLayer(TodosState.Default("todos"))
|
||||
return <div>Hello "/"!</div>
|
||||
Effect.fn("Route")(function*() {
|
||||
return yield* Effect.provide(
|
||||
ReactComponent.use(Todos, Todos => <Todos />),
|
||||
yield* ReactHook.useMemoLayer(TodosState.Default("todos")),
|
||||
)
|
||||
}),
|
||||
|
||||
ReactComponent.withDisplayName("Index"),
|
||||
|
||||
Reference in New Issue
Block a user